GABAB1e promotes the malignancy of human cancer cells by targeting the tyrosine phosphatase PTPN12
Summary: Neurotransmitter receptors are involved in cancer progression. Among them, the heterodimeric GABAB receptor, activated by the main inhibitory neurotransmitter GABA, is composed of the transmembrane GABAB1 and GABAB2 subunits.
